Deadwood snapshot update: A working Windows service

OK, I've made some progress with Deadwood today. It does work as a Windows service, but its service code has a number of kinks I need to iron out:
  • The service can be started but not stopped without using the task manager to kill the process
  • The service has issues with removing the service from the service registry
  • There is no proper logging of Deadwood
  • I have some basic documentation, but really need to properly document this service
